About this skill
Search persistent cross-session memory to answer questions about previous work and past solutions. Search past work across all sessions. Simple workflow: search -> filter -> fetch. Use when users ask about PREVIOUS sessions (not current conversation): NEVER fetch full details without filtering first. 10x token savings. Use the search MCP tool: Returns: Table with IDs, timestamps, types, titles (~50-100 tokens/result) Parameters: Use the timeline MCP tool: Or find anchor automatically from query: Returns: depth_before + 1 + depth_after items in chronological order with observations, sessions, and prompts interleaved around the anchor. Parameters: Review titles from Step 1 and context from Step 2. Pick relevant IDs.
